WebSep 15, 2024 · Cleft lip and cleft palate are openings or splits in the upper lip, the roof of the mouth (palate) or both. Cleft lip and cleft palate result when facial structures that are developing in an unborn baby don't close …
WebCleft lips and palates occur during the first weeks of development in the womb. The lips are initially formed in three parts and palate in two halves, lying either side of the tongue. ... Diagnosis of a cleft lip is possible by ultrasound scan during pregnancy. It may be spotted during the routine 20 week anomaly scan.
